Website visitor identification
When you visit avolis.ai from the United States, we run a service called ZoomInfo WebSights. It reads your IP address and matches it against a database of business networks to tell us which company visited. We use that to understand which businesses our content is reaching.
What we see is company-level. It tells us that someone at a given organization visited, which pages they looked at, and when.
This service runs only for visitors in the United States. If you are visiting from anywhere else, it never loads and no data reaches ZoomInfo.

Opt out on this browser
Setting this stores a preference on this browser for one year. While it is set, the identification service never loads for you.
Two things worth knowing. The preference lives in a cookie, so clearing your cookies clears it and you will need to set it again. It also applies to this browser alone, so setting it on your laptop leaves your phone unchanged.
Global Privacy Control
If your browser sends the Global Privacy Control signal, we honor it automatically and you do not need to do anything on this page. We apply it to every visitor wherever you live, rather than only where the law requires it.
Brave and Firefox can send this signal from their built-in settings, and extensions are available for Chrome and Safari.
